The Grey Lynn Community Centre, located at 510 Richmond Road in Grey Lynn, Auckland, is a vibrant hub offering a wide array of services, programs, and spaces for the local community.
Established in 1975 and redeveloped in 2000, It provides various activities and support services, including a school holiday programmes, playgroups, classes and workshops. The centre also hosts support services such as the Citizens Advice Bureau, Justice of the Peace clinics, and Plunket.
For hire, the centre has several versatile spaces including a main hall (capacity 200), the Garden Room (capacity 70), the Oval Room, and the Balcony Room (both with a capacity of 20). These spaces are suitable for meetings, workshops, classes, functions, and more, and come equipped with tables, chairs, and AV equipment for an additional fee.
The Grey Lynn Community Centre is managed by the Grey Lynn Community Centre Trust. The building is owened by Auckland Councill. The Community Centre actively promotes sustainability through initiatives like battery and soft plastic recycling.
Every Sunday morning the centre comes alive as the venue for the Grey Lynn Farmers Market.
